Working Principle
They use multi - layer construction. The outer layer acts as a physical barrier, while internal sound - absorbing materials convert sound energy into heat. For instance, fiberglass wool traps and dissipates sound waves.
Advantages
Noise Reduction: Significantly cuts noise, creating a quieter environment and helping meet regulations.
Durability: Withstands harsh industrial conditions like dust, moisture, and impacts.
Easy Installation and Maintenance: Saves time and effort.
Application Scenarios
Industrial Settings: Cover noisy machinery such as generators, compressors, and pumps.
Recording Studios: Eliminate external noise for high - quality audio recording.
Research Laboratories: Provide a quiet environment for sensitive experiments.
